Lilah Morgan had not wanted to go home after her time as a field nurse in The Great War. Not to Canada and all her old memories. And definitely not back to the nunnery that she'd lied about her aged to get away from.
And so in 1918 somehow she'd ended up in Birmingham. And like a plant she'd grown strong in the close-knit family of the shelby's. 
 Two years later she left back to Frances for another 'better life'.

When she returns they are in worse trouble than ever before but who can say no to family. 

Everyone welcomes her home, but Thomas.

	"You think I would betray my family?" She whispered.
	He pauses at that, and stared up at her from where his eyes had fallen to the table as if reading his investigation from a script.
	There was nothing there in those eyes, as he said, "Family-maybe; but not blood."
